Description Suggest change

The King's Pawn is more a point on the Apache-Shoshoni ridge than a freestanding tower, but its fierce exposure to the south and west make it a worthy destination for the Kasparov Traverse adventurer. It is a long way up the hill from the Rook to the King's Pawn. Work up on ledges and slabs staying near the ridge crest. As you near the summit you can stay east of the ridge for a pleasant ascent or go west of the ridge and climb the summit block from the south to enjoy tremendous exposure.
